Share via


Erstellen und Ausführen von Komponententests für Store-Apps in Visual Studio

Die Komponententesttools von Visual Studio 2012 Express für Windows 8 sind darauf ausgelegt, Entwickler und Teams zu unterstützen, die Komponententests in ihre Softwareentwicklungsverfahren einbinden. Mit Komponententests erhalten Entwickler und Tester eine effiziente, leicht verwaltbare Methode für die Suche nach logischen Fehlern in den Methoden von Klassen in Visual C#-, Visual Basic- und Visual C++-Projekten.

Hinweis

In den Themen in diesem Abschnitt wird die Funktionalität von Visual Studio 2012 Express für Windows 8 beschrieben.Visual Studio Ultimate, VS Premium und VS Professional stellen zusätzliche Funktionen für Komponententests bereit.

  • Mit VS Ultimate, VS Premium und VS Professional können Sie ein beliebiges Drittanbieter- oder Open Source-Komponententest-Framework verwenden, mit dem ein Add-On-Adapter für den Microsoft-Test-Explorer erstellt wurde.Sie können außerdem Codeabdeckungsinformationen für Ihre Tests analysieren und anzeigen.

  • In VS Ultimate können Sie Ihre Tests nach jedem Build ausführen.Sie können zudem Microsoft Fakes verwenden, ein Isolationsframework für verwalteten Code, mit dem Sie Ihre Tests auf den eigenen Code ausrichten können, indem Sie Testcode für System- und Drittanbieterfunktionalität ersetzen.

  • JavaScript.JavaScript-Komponententests sind über die IDE von Visual Studio Express für Windows 8 nicht verfügbar.In Visual Studio Professional, Premium und Ultimate sind JavaScript-Komponententest-Frameworks als Erweiterungen in der Visual Studio Gallery verfügbar.Sie können JavaScript-Code außerdem testen, indem Sie eins der eigenständigen Drittanbieter- oder Open-Source-JavaScript-Komponententest-Frameworks verwenden.

Weitere Informationen finden Sie unter Überprüfen von Code mithilfe von Komponententests in der MSDN Library.

In diesem Abschnitt

Komponententest von Visual C#-Code in einer Store-App

Komponententest bei einer Visual C++-DLL für Store-Apps

Ausführen von Komponententests für Store-Apps in Visual Studio